#e5e2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e5e2ce is composed of 89.8% red, 88.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 10%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 52.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.7% and a lightness of 85.3%. #e5e2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cbc59d.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#e5e2ce color description : Light grayish yellow.
#e5e2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e5e2ce has RGB values of R:229, G:226,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.1,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15065806.
